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: broken, balanced out or collapsed pipe: Pipes have been harmed due to moving soil, frozen ground, settling, etc.
Blockage: Grease buildup or a foreign item is restricting or prohibiting correct flow and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ipeline has actually deteriorated and/or broken, causing collapses in the line and restricting circulation.
Bellied pipe: An area of the pipeline has actually sunk due to ground or soil conditions, creating a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Leaking joints: The seals in between pipelines have actually broken, permitting water to leave into the area surrounding the pipeline.
Root in drain line: Tree or shrub roots have actually gotten into the sewage system line and/or have harmed the line, preventing normal cleaning.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ipes are built of subpar product that might have weakened or worn away.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Sewage system line repair is usually carried out using the "open cut" or "trench" approach to get to the location surrounding the damaged portion of the pipeline. A backhoe might be utilized to open and fill up the workspace.

Pipe Bursting

We make little access holes where the damaged pipeline starts and ends. Using your damaged sewage system line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ipeline through the old path and breaks up the damaged pipeline at the same time. The new pipeline is highly resistant to leaks and root invasion, with a long life span.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the procedure of fixing damaged sewer pipelines by creating a "pipeline within a pipeline" to restore function and circulation. Epoxy relining products mold to the inside of the existing pipe to produce a smooth brand-new inner wall, much like the lining discovered in food cans.

Many times, pipeline relining can be performed through a building's clean-out gain access to and frequently needs little digging. Pipe relining might be used to repair root-damaged pipelines; seal fractures and holes; and fill out missing out on pipe and seal joint connections underground, in roofing system drain pipes,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ipe is smooth and long lasting, and all materials utilized in the relining procedure are non-hazardous.
